Form 4: Copart Director Matt Blunt Exercises Stock Options and Sells Shares
SEC Form 4
Director Matt Blunt exercised stock options and sold 100,000 shares of Copart Inc. common stock on February 26, 2024.
Summary
- On February 26, 2024, Matt Blunt, a director of Copart Inc., exercised stock options to acquire 100,000 shares of common stock.
- The options were exercised at prices of $22.145 and $28.0225 per share, resulting in the acquisition of 50,000 shares at each price.
- Simultaneously, Blunt sold 100,000 shares of Copart common stock at a price of $51.06 per share.
- Following these transactions, Blunt directly owns no shares of Copart common stock, but retains options to purchase 50,000 shares.
